Latest Patents
Yoriko Sameshima holds a patent for a lithium-manganese dioxide cell. This invention comprises a cathode made of manganese dioxide, an anode composed of metal lithium, and an electrolyte interposed between them. The manganese dioxide exhibits an X-ray diffraction peak near a diffraction crystal lattice distance of d=3.60 Å, analyzed after discharging in a cell. The preparation of manganese dioxide involves adding nitric acid to electrolytic manganese dioxide (EMD), chemical manganese dioxide (CMD), or products obtained through heat treatment or thermal decomposition of these materials.
Career Highlights
Yoriko Sameshima is associated with Sony Corporation, where she has been instrumental in advancing battery technology. Her work has not only contributed to the company's innovative product lineup but has also positioned her as a key figure in the field of energy storage solutions. With a total of 1 patent, her contributions are recognized within the industry.
